Transaction ff76dfebd80e9ef103002c76ed1213c413bb4bf76c428c822c28404d8ea44990

3 Input
1 Outputs
  • ff76dfebd80e9ef103002c76ed1213c413bb4bf76c428c822c28404d8ea44990:0
  • value  3550076
    address  16TPP7apJTBvaasMK5szdZkuxFPW3Z58Zy